And together, we will Move the world towards easy and sustainable. The Position We are strengthening our Information Security team at our headquarters in Mjölby. As an Information Security Specialist, you will be part of our increasing efforts improving the information security and risk management within Toyota Material Handling Europe (TMHE). Your Responsibilities As part of our information security team, you will contribute to building and maintaining a secure foundation for our organization. Together, we: Drive strategic development: Shape strategies, principles, and policies to address current and future risks in TMHE's evolving IT-landscape. Ensure compliance and fulfilment: Manage compliance efforts and requirement fulfilment for entities and operational objects. Provide risk assessments and expert advisory support. Translate policies into action: Convert information security policies and frameworks into effective technical controls. Establish secure reporting mechanisms and relevant metrics. Collaborate across functions: Partner with key departments such as procurement and legal to align security efforts with broader organizational goals. Promote risk awareness: Lead risk coordination efforts in IS/IT, improve processes, and increase awareness organization-wide. Raise security awareness: Develop and deliver educational initiatives that build understanding and encourage a culture of security. Contribute as an expert: Depending on your expertise, take the lead in information security projects, act as Information security expert in IS/IT projects, implement classification frameworks, perform risk analyses, provide security training, and/or review changes to ensure compliance and secure implementation. Your Profile We are looking for an experienced, self-driven information security professional with the following qualifications and traits: Broad Expertise: You have knowledge and experience in various information security areas, such as risk management, information classification, assurance activities, and establishing security policies. Education within relevant area and/or experience in information and IT security, with a strong interest in driving security initiatives. Framework Proficiency: Skilled in security practices grounded in established methods, legislation, and frameworks. Comfortable collaborating with legal, audit, and compliance teams. Technical Acumen: Experienced in security work within hybrid and cloud environments, particularly in large organizations. Professional Credentials: Certifications such as CISM, CISSP, or equivalents are an advantage. Inspirational Leadership: Passionate about guiding and promoting security awareness, serving as an ambassador within your field of expertise. Cultural Fit: Aligned with our values of teamwork, respect, and challenge, and committed to enhancing our security posture. Adaptability and Confidence: Comfortable acting as both an expert advisor and a leader in various security-related initiatives. Communication Skills: Fluent in spoken and written English, able to communicate complex topics effectively. We are now seeking an R&D Project Manager to join us on our ongoing journey of innovation and growth. You will be part of a strong and supportive project management team leading the development of manual and automatic warehouse trucks, smart and connected, including development of the onboard energy system. Your primary field would be within automatic unmanned vehicles or development of safety assistance solutions. You will work at our R&D Project Management Office, where innovation meets teamwork, planning and leading product development projects to achieve strategic goals. Acting on behalf of the project sponsor, you'll collaborate with cross-functional teams of engineers and experts, driving ideas from concept to reality. You will report to the Manager R&D Project Lead. Your Responsibilities Drive projects to success by engaging and motivating team members while resolving challenges. Build and manage the project team, ensuring clear roles and accountability. Identify risks and deviations, implementing effective mitigation strategies. Develop and monitor schedules, milestones, and deliverables. Oversee the project lifecycle from concept to industrialisation and production launch. Keep sponsors, stakeholders, and teams informed with clear, regular updates. Suggest process improvements to enhance efficiency and outcomes. Contribute to strategic discussions shaping the future of R&D initiatives. Your Profile We highly value your personal qualities. You are curious in both people and technology, you have a strong personal drive, an ability to see the overall picture but also understand when it is time to dig into details. Project management experience, preferably with Product Development, in agile roles or other senior technical leadership positions. Certification and experience in PMI/IPMA or ISO 21 500 methodologies are an advantage. Excellent communication and presentation skills, with the ability to collaborate with stakeholders across different levels of the organization. Fluent in English and Swedish, both written and spoken. Bachelor's or master's degree in a relevant field, or equivalent professional experience. The Position Toyota Material Handling Commercial Finance AB offers financial products for Toyota Material Handling customers across Europe via internal sales companies, external dealers and branches in France, Italy, and Germany. We are now strengthening our team and are looking for an engaged Business System Specialist. You will work with other functions within the organisation to ensure successful implementation. Your Responsibility Your main responsibility in the role is split between four parts, System Analysis & Design, Implementation & Support, Improvement & Optimization and Collaboration & Communication. Collaborate with business stakeholders to understand and document requirements for system improvements or new implementations. Analyze existing business processes and workflows, identifying areas for automation and optimization. Develop functional and technical specifications for system changes. Work with IT teams and vendors to implement system solutions that meet business needs. Conduct system testing, including unit, integration, and user acceptance testing (UAT). Provide ongoing support, troubleshooting, and issue resolution for business systems. Identify opportunities for improving business processes using technology. Develop and maintain system documentation, including process maps, user guides, and training materials. Facilitate meetings, workshops, and training sessions to gather requirements and provide system updates. Your Profile A couple of years' experience in business systems analysis, IT support, or related roles. Strong understanding of business processes and enterprise systems (ERP, CRM) Experience with system configuration, testing, and troubleshooting. Strong ability to communicate with different stakeholders Strong analytical and problem-solving skills. Ability to work independently and manage multiple projects. Fluent in both spoken and written English Degree in Information Systems, Business Administration, Computer Science, or a related field.
